MCCB for line protection — 20 A continuous, 121 kA interrupting
The Siemens SENTRON 3VA1120-4EF36-0AE0 is a 3-pole molded case circuit breaker (MCCB) designed for line protection — meaning it guards feeder circuits against overload and short-circuit, not motor or generator duty. Its TM240 thermal-magnetic release is fixed at 20 A and holds that rating from 40 °C through 55 °C; at 60 °C it derates to 19 A, and stays at 19 A up to 70 °C. Short-circuit breaking capacity reaches 121 kA at 240 V, 75.6 kA at 415 V, 52.5 kA at 440 V, and 11.9 kA at both 500 V and 690 V. That 121 kA figure at 240 V is the highest in the 3VA1 family — this breaker clears a fault fast enough to protect downstream gear even on high-capacity transformers. Rated insulation voltage is 800 V, and the breaker dissipates 12 W maximum under full load — useful to know for enclosure thermal budgeting.
Panel fit — 76.2 mm wide, 70 mm deep, 130 mm tall
The 3VA1120-4EF36-0AE0 occupies a 76.2 mm wide footprint on the DIN rail or mounting plate, with a depth of 70 mm and height of 130 mm. That 70 mm depth is shallow enough to clear most standard gland plates and backpanel wiring troughs without protruding into the wiring channel. Operating temperature range is -25 °C to 70 °C; storage range is -40 °C to 80 °C. The 12 W power loss is conducted through the base and terminals — no fan required in a ventilated enclosure at 20 A continuous.
